    Abstract: The connector assembly includes a housing with an open bore which extends along an axis from an open first end to an open second end. The housing further includes a plurality of fingers that are spaced circumferentially from one another and are deflectable in a radial direction. At least one of the fingers has a plurality of teeth that are spaced axially from one another and extend into the open bore of the housing for biting into the first tube to resist pull out of the first tube from the open bore. Each of the teeth also extends by a height to a leading edge of an engagement surface which also includes an angled portion that extends at an angle relative to the axis. The axially spaced teeth have at least one of differing heights and differing angles of the angled portions.

    Abstract: An anchoring device has an insert sleeve and an expanding rivet. The insert sleeve is anchorable in an insert recess of a support part via engagement tongues. In a final assembly configuration, spreading arms of the expansion rivet are situated in arm clearances of the insert sleeve by the action of an expansion shank of a rivet pin, and are engaged with retaining edges of the insert sleeve. In this manner, the mounting part is removably connected to the support part with the expansion shank removable from the rivet body by releasing the spreading arms from the insert sleeve in order to release the connection.

    Abstract: A lock (10) for a tubular connection, blocked axially in a first tubular element and defining an axial opening (14) receiving a second tubular element provided with a circular collar, said lock (10) comprising elastically deformable cradles provided with inside bevels (13) designed so that, while the second tubular element is axially engaged, they move radially apart under the effect of the axial pressure of the circular collar, allow same to pass through, and then move back in to clamp behind the circular collar and to co-operate therewith to lock the second tubular element axially in the first tubular element. Each cradle (11) is provided with a raised axial ridge (15) with a width (l) less than the width (L) of the cradle (11), and is intended during the axial engagement, to receive the axial thrust from the circular collar. A tubular connector is obtained with such a lock (10).

    Abstract: A method and apparatus for transferring formed adhesive elements from a reservoir (30) containing plural formed adhesive elements (12) to a bonding part attachable to a glass surface or other substrate through the use of adhesives. Transfer of the formed adhesive element to the bonding part (14) is accomplished by use of a vacuum tool (10) having a vacuum outlet, an internal plenum, and a series of vacuum lines formed in an adhesive element holding face. The vacuum tool is positioned over a reservoir of formed adhesive elements. Once the formed adhesive elements have been captured by the vacuum tool (10) the tool is used to place them into contact with the heated bonding part (14) directly or indirectly by intermediate placement onto a matrix (60) having a plurality of ejector pins (72) movably fitted therein. The ejector pins move the formed adhesive elements into position against the bonding part.

    Abstract: A buffer device with a self-adjustable stop comprises a buffer head (5) in the form of a shank presenting along its length a flat and touching ribs or grooves (6), and a socket (8) into which the buffer head in the form of a shank can be driven axially, serration by serration. The device further comprises an annular ring (7) inserted axially in an axial bore in said socket and presenting a bottom edge defining a thrust ramp. The ring has an inner surface presenting a smooth strip and an adjacent serrated strip such that actuating the ring by turning it causes the buffer head to be raised and its axial position to be blocked.

    Abstract: A retainer assembly for retaining a panel to a component. The retainer assembly includes a base defining a bore for receiving a screw. A pair of front and back support members each have a first section connected to the base, and a second section that overlies the bore for flexing outwardly in response to being engaged by the screw. A front and back primary retention member each extend outwardly from the front and back support members for holding the retainer assembly relative to the panel. A pair of front and back secondary retention members each extend outwardly from the first section of the front and back support members. The front and back secondary retention members terminate closer to the base than the front and back primary retention members to establish an interference fit between the retainer assembly and the panel prior to the screw being driven through the retainer assembly.
